Itinerary:

Join me on this tough hike along the curiosly named Chunky Gal Trail. This trail is known for its steep climbs and rugged terrain.  It's a solid D6 hike with extended and challenging climbs totaling about 18 miles and about 4500 ft elevation gain.

We'll start where the trail crosses hwy-64 and head up Boteler Peak for an awesome view of Chatuge Lake and the Hiawasee and Hayesville area. Then it's  back down to the cars and across the road for the climb up to the intersecion with the AT.  Expect some steep sections and blowdown along the way. There's an optional detour down the AT to the site of a plane crash near Whiteoak Stamp and Muskrat Creek Shelter.

Stories about the origin of the "Chunky Gal" name vary. One legend tells of a young Cherokee woman who left her family to be with a man from another tribe.  Another suggests it's derived from a native American game called "Chunque".

This is a tough D6 hike of 18 miles and 4500 ft.  The average pace should be 2.7-2.8 mph.  Be sure you're comfortable with hikes lasting up to 7 hours including faster pace sections of 3.0+ mph.
